Kikorangi: Colour Run Questions



Today we were inspired to create our own problems about the colour run:
Renee's Problem:
If 500 people were at the run and 134 people received spot prizes,  How many people missed out?

Renee split the 134 into 100 and 34.
Then went 500 - 100 = 400
400 - 34 = ?  400 - 30 = 370
370 - 4 = 366.

Renee could split the numbers and work out the answer was 366 people missed out.  In our group two people won spot prizes.
